On Sunday 13 June 2010 18:11:47 Christian Ohm wrote:
> Package: libglewmx1.5
> Version: 1.5.4-1
> Severity: grave
> Justification: renders package unusable
> 
> Hello,
> 
> after upgrading to the above version, any program using libglc (i.e.
> cromium-bsu and warzone2100) crash as soon as they try rendering text.
> Backtrace:
> 
> #0  0x00007ffff69f83f0 in __glcRenderCharTexture () from
> /usr/lib/libGLC.so.0 #1  0x00007ffff69f5c2e in ?? () from
> /usr/lib/libGLC.so.0
> #2  0x00007ffff69ef72f in __glcProcessChar () from /usr/lib/libGLC.so.0
> #3  0x00007ffff69f547a in ?? () from /usr/lib/libGLC.so.0
> #4  0x00007ffff69f5635 in glcRenderString () from /usr/lib/libGLC.so.0
> #5  0x00000000006006b1 in iV_DrawTextRotated (string=0xccec20 "Version 2.3
> branch r10963 - Built Jun 13 2010 - DEBUG", XPos=1391, YPos=1036,
> rotation=90) at ../../../lib/ivis_opengl/textdraw.c:648
> 
> Warzone is compiled from SVN, but chromium-bsu from the Debian repo also
> crashes. Downgrading libglewmx1.5 to 1.5.3-2 makes things work again.
